Specific function: General (non sugar-specific) component of the phosphoenolpyruvate-dependent sugar phosphotransferase system (sugar PTS). This major carbohydrate active-transport system catalyzes the phosphorylation of incoming sugar substrates concomitantly with their tr
COG id: COG1080
COG function: function code G; Phosphoenolpyruvate-protein kinase (PTS system EI component in bacteria)
